百度
360搜索
搜狗搜索

在PHP中判断一个变量是否为整数详细介绍

  在写PHP代码的时候遇到这样一个小问题:如何判断一个变量是否为整数,于是在网上找到了两个方法来解决,在此做一个小小的记录。

  方法1

<?php
 $num=12; //返回right
 //$num=12.1 返回false
 if(is_int($num)){
  echo "right";
 }else{
  echo "false"; 
  }
?>

  这里用is_int()方法来判断传入的参数是否为整数形(int),而不是判断它是否为整数,略显局限。

  方法2

<?php
 $num=12;
 if(floor($num)==$num){
  echo "right";
 }else{
  echo "false"; 
  }
?>

  floor()方法是将传入的参数进行四舍五入。将四舍或者五入后的值与原来的值比较,若相等则为整数,不等则不为整数。 

阅读更多 >>>  初级php程序员招聘,php程序员去哪里接单

文章数据信息:

本文主要探讨:"在PHP中判断一个变量是否为整数", 浏览人数已经达到37次, 首屏加载时间:2.111 秒。